Hydrogen peroxide solution, with the chemical formula H2O2, is commonly known as hydrogen peroxide in its aqueous solution. It is a colorless, transparent liquid and is a strong oxidant suitable for wound disinfection, environmental disinfection, and food disinfection. The uses of hydrogen peroxide are divided into three categories: medical, military and industrial. Medical hydrogen peroxide is used for daily disinfection. Medical hydrogen peroxide can kill intestinal pathogens and pyogenic cocci and is generally used for surface disinfection of objects. Hydrogen peroxide has an oxidizing effect, but the concentration of medical hydrogen peroxide is equal to or lower than 3%. Health Hazards: Concentrated hydrogen peroxide is highly corrosive. Inhalation of the vapor or mist of this product is highly irritating to the respiratory tract. Direct eye contact with liquid can cause irreversible damage or even blindness. Oral poisoning may cause abdominal pain, chest pain, difficulty breathing, vomiting, temporary movement and sensory disorders, and fever. Some cases may experience visual impairment, epileptic convulsions, and mild paralysis.
